This pull request focuses on enhancing local build performance by integrating Bazel's disk caching mechanism. By enabling and configuring a dedicated disk cache, the aim is to significantly reduce build times, especially for complex tasks like building documentation that involve dependencies such as protobuf. This change ensures that previously computed build artifacts are reused, leading to a more efficient development workflow.

Highlights

  • Bazel Disk Cache Enabled: The pull request enables the disk cache for Bazel builds, which is crucial for speeding up local build processes.
  • Cache Path Configuration: A specific path, ~/.cache/bazel/bazel-disk-cache, has been configured in .bazelrc for the local disk cache.

This pull request enables a local disk cache for Bazel to speed up local builds, which is a great improvement for developer experience. I've added one suggestion to make the cache path version-specific. This follows Bazel's best practices to avoid potential cache corruption issues when developers switch between different Bazel versions. Otherwise, the change looks good.
